The Pin Insertion Machine Market was valued at USD 216.47 million in 2023, expected to reach USD 231.75 million in 2024, and is projected to grow at a CAGR of 7.54%, to USD 360.16 million by 2030.

Pin insertion machines are specialized equipment used in manufacturing and electronics assembly processes to automatically insert pins into various components such as connectors, circuit boards, and other electronic assemblies. The necessity for these machines arises from the growing demand for automation to enhance production efficiency, precision, and consistency in industries such as automotive, telecommunication, consumer electronics, and aerospace. Their application spans across automated production lines where reliable and rapid insertion of contact pins is critical. The market for pin insertion machines is primarily driven by the increasing complexity and miniaturization of electronic devices, which demand precise and error-free assembly processes. Additionally, key growth factors include advancements in automation technology, rising labor costs prompting a shift towards automated manufacturing, and the surge in demand for smart devices. Potential opportunities lie in emerging markets where industrial automation is in its nascent stages but expected to grow due to industrialization and digital transformation. Additionally, integrating advanced technologies such as artificial intelligence and machine learning for predictive maintenance and enhanced functionality offers significant potential. The market, however, faces limitations such as high initial investment costs, the need for skilled personnel to operate complex machinery, and challenges related to technical compatibility with existing production lines. Stringent regulations and standards in electronic manufacturing can also present barriers to entry. For business growth, innovation in developing more adaptable and flexible machines that can cater to a wide range of applications is crucial. Similarly, ongoing research into improving the precision and speed of these machines, alongside reducing their operational footprint, could provide competitive advantages. The nature of the market is highly competitive with a focus on technological advancements, making continuous innovation essential for maintaining market position.
